Ticket: Slimcrate builds failing — expired credentials

New folks: Slimcrate (our container image slimming service) rejects jobs since Tuesday because its internal API key expired. Symptom: 401 at the squash step. Fix is a config update in the build runner; no code changes needed. Rotate quarterly going forward — add a calendar reminder. Replacement key follows below.

API key for kawif-fajop: kto2_37

### Audit Item 14: Batch Email Digest Scheduling

Verify that Driftnote digest jobs run on the published schedule and that skipped batches are logged with a reason code. Support should confirm no customer-facing digests were silently dropped this quarter. Any schedule override requires documented approval from the responsible owner, who is named below.

signatory, yagug-fadup: Silmir Fraax Istael

Subject: Currency-Hedging Decision

Heads of department: following Tuesday's review, we will hedge seventy percent of forecast kroner exposure on the Nordvik contract for the next four quarters, using forwards rather than options. The premium saving outweighs the flexibility loss at current volatility. Treasury will adjust cover monthly as forecasts update; please submit revised demand figures promptly. The confidential note on related business plans follows directly below.

board note of kageg-bahof: The renewal with Holwynax Holdings closes at $2 million a year, 5 percent below the last contract. Project Ulaath slips by two quarters because of the supplier delay.